Output dd86453edabcf611ee31e95831fc3389c6cd7a4eec3baf57f21733483158181a:0

value
821460216
script pubkey
OP_0 OP_PUSHBYTES_20 55cdf8818e7becb444cdda3244b27391a12d0e93
address
ltc1q2hxl3qvw00ktg3xdmgeyfvnnjxsj6r5nmr8f6l
transaction
dd86453edabcf611ee31e95831fc3389c6cd7a4eec3baf57f21733483158181a
spent
true